What to carry has always caused me to rethink my key ring carry items.  How to carry is never been really an issue. 

I like the Victorinox Belt Hanger a lot.  I don't like attaching things to my belt loops.  This has been the game changer for me.  I can use the clip to attach things to go into my pocket.  I can also attach things to the ring thats attached to the belt clip.

Here are two items that I had on my tools keychain for a long time.  My Manager in sheath was my most carried tool.  I changed out for a Midnight Manager.  My LM #4 I got when they came out and it went straight onto my keychain.  It just might go back.  I was slimming my keychain down and it didn't make the cut.  No fault of it at all.  I had to make a cut.

I've revised my keychain countless times.  I still do more or less.
